Transaction 178e87d35dbfebcaa360c897438710623d230582620bde93e658371a7820527c
1 Input
1 Output
-
178e87d35dbfebcaa360c897438710623d230582620bde93e658371a7820527c:0
- value
- 298416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58145cd56e51c3aa80695f221bb1f2c7ef35601d OP_EQUAL
- address
- 39ijnFBPcoBkRLhLSve5xXfv6iP3ZdEAhe